What happened
Trump told Fox News the United States could seize the Strait of Hormuz if needed and charge transit fees. He framed the choke point as a place where Washington could control a significant share of oil traffic.
- 01Trump said the U.S. could take over the Strait of Hormuz if needed.
- 02He claimed Washington could collect transit fees there.
- 03He said the strait handles about 20% of the oil.
- 04The remarks were made in an interview with Fox News.
